After a fantastic spot and stalk hunt on a huge place with Iliwa Safarias in SA I have been waiting for our animals to arrive home.
They got here and I had them officially measured. I was a bit surprised to find we took 6 book animals which were most of the animals we brought home.
Here is a run down of them:
Waterbuck scored 76 6/8"---book 70"
Impala scored 61 5/8" book 54"
Impala scoed 54 5/8" book 54"
Red Hartebeest scored 68 7/8" book 62"
Blue Wildebeest scored 78" book 70"
Blesbuck scored 44 3/8" book 39"

Gemsbuck missed by 3" and Springbuck missed by 2"
Not bad for a budget hunt for an old, fat, partly cripped guy and his daughter. All were one shot kills using a 257Roberts(my daughter) and 338win mag (me) at ranges from 135 yards to 480 yards. I am a happy hunter now waiting on the hides to get tanned then the mounts done.
